You’ll learn

Design

Set your veggie gardens, fruit and chooks up for a strong beginning with my simple take on the permaculture design process.

Lay a strong foundation

Become a soil-building champion, forage for fertility, learn natural pest and disease management, winning ways with weeds and how to plant in guilds.

Build

Greenhouse, berryhouse, no dig veggie beds, perennial companions and set up the orchard with my practical ways.

Grow

Tools, raising seedlings and simple seed saving, watering how to’s, crop rotation, greencrops and the easiest compost in the world.

Know your crops

The lowdown on timing, sowing and growing for vegetable crops plus my favourite perennial vegetables, herbs, nuts, fruit and a few berries too.

Month by month

My monthly growing guide in the veggie patch, greenhouse and orchard to bring you a steady, daily harvest with ease.
